Got a vintage 1920s home, lovingly restored to reflect that breathless era of glamour, adventure and invention?

The period home deserves more than a mod iPod dock on the side table to pump out your mood music, or even a discreet black box with speakers.

Posh Prezzies’ Spirit of St. Louis collection of home technology products is crafted to replicate the style of Lindbergh-era gadgets, all fascinating knobs and shiny dials and rich wood details. 1920s style CD player - SOSL Collection - closeup

Each CD player or clock radio in the collection is an evocation of the Golden Age of romance — when Old Hollywood reigned — when luxury ocean liners and velvet-cushioned ralway cars were the height of travel style — and when a human voice carried across the airwaves was still as miraculous as man’s ability to take flight across the Atlantic.
